Spain maintains a border in the Pyrenees mountains with France and Andorra. Spain has a border running throughout the Iberian Peninsula with Portugal for all regions due south of Galicia. Finally, Spain maintains land boundaries with Morocco for the autonomous cities of Ceuta and Melilla.

the divisions of Spain are called administrative divisions and below are the names of all 17 of them.

andalusia, aragon, asturias, balearic islands, basque provinces, canary islands, cantabria, castile-la mancha, castile-leon, catalonia, extremadura, galicia, la rioja, Madrid, murcia, navarre, and valencia

Treaty of tordesillas of 1494?

A treaty in 1494 between the Crown of Portugal and the Crown of Spain that split the world West of Europe in two divisions. The line was drawn at 2,193 kilometres West of the Cape Verde Islands (which were owned by Portugal at the time). Anything to the East was under Portuguese jurisdiction, to the West was given to Spain. This helped/had consequences for the later divisions of Brazil and Western Spanish South America.
